Software security is becoming increasingly important due to numerous emerging threats exploiting software vulnerabilities.
< p>T his course begins with a broad overview of various software security threat s and some of the most effective countermeasures used to thwart them. More specifically, software practitioners will learn how to build security into their software products throughout their lifecycle, using best practices an d tools to minimize the chance of falling victim to a software attack.This course will also provide a comprehensive coverage of practical k nowledge in how to design secure software as well as insights on the signif icance of the role secure design plays during the software development life cycle. Some of the critical topics covered in this course include secure d esign principles and processes in addition to fundamental security concepts such as access control and encryption. This course also devotes a signific ant amount of time to discussing well-known secure design solutions, includ ing architectural patterns and design patterns focusing on security counter measures and concludes with the discussion of software security analysis an d evaluation as mechanisms to assess the effectiveness of the secure design solutions implemented in the form of source code.
